Blackwood Photographic Club Annual Exhibition 2025
Our Annual Exhibition was held on Thursday December 4th with a good turn-out of members to celebrate our achievements for the year. Peter Phillips, one of our judges, was a special guest. He presented the awards.
There were three specialist category awards:
The Best Portrait Award was won by Meredith Retallack with Apprehensive


The WEA Landscape Award was won by Duart Mclean with River Reflections


The Best Still Life Award was won by Sarah Bailey with Ranuncula in Profile
